In spite of being an older principle of installing saddlebags, throw-over saddlebags are still a favored choice of several riders. The throw-over saddlebags typically include baggage bags that are made from soft and light-weight artificial material that are simple to install on the saddle without specialized placing equipment. There may be a couple of strong straps linking both bags and this same large strap is overlooked the saddle to maintain the bags dealt with in location.


They are likewise cheaper as they do not included specialized installing setting up and devices to place them on your motorcycle. You do not need to invest money for the installment or need specialized help to install throw-over satchels on your bike. Motorbike Luggage NZ. They are the most excellent if you have to go on an unplanned trip and you do not have time to set up hard-mounted saddlebags


These motorcycle bags are generally portable and light and they do not affect the general handling of the bike and make it heavy. You do not have to keep specialized devices with you to mount and eliminate the throw-over saddlebags from your motorcycle. Throw-over bags do not give a cleaner and excellent seek to your motorbike as they are not securely mounted or bolted to the back frame.

They are somewhat less safe than hard-mounted satchels as they incline a lot more towards the back wheel and can cause obstruction in the spinning of the wheel. Because of not being securely mounted, throw-over satchels can move a great deal during the ride, creating diversion to the biker. They are mostly made from soft material and are generally little and portable because of which they use small storage space.


Hard-mounted satchels are one of the most regularly used and most preferred baggage bag options nowadays. They are firmly installed on a motorcycle to limit any kind of type of activity and vibrations during the experience. There are absolutely no possibilities that the hard-mounted bags will come off or fly away during the ride because of being firmly placed.


You can bring lots of stuff in hard-mounted bags for long-mile scenic tours and motorbike journeys. Hard-mounted satchels live longer and they do not warp easily as they are primarily constructed from hard product. Motorbike Luggage NZ. Hard-mounted satchels are likewise a more secure option compared to throw-over or soft satchels as they are rigid and there are no chances of them coming closer to the rear wheel


It can take a couple of mins to an hour to set up these bags securely on your motorbike. These bags are additionally pricey as they include installing setting up. Hard-mounted and throw-over motorcycle saddlebags have their own set of advantages and disadvantages and riders might say which look at here now one is the best depending upon their preferences and style of riding.

But prior to we look into details products, let's develop the basic standards for safeguarding challenge your linked here motorcycle.


Most items I'm covering utilize a girth drawback to secure to the motorcycleessentially, the strap has a loop on one end that is covered around a tie-down point on the bike, then back via itself, making a link factor click that can not come loose. Some bikes have several accessory points; others have few.


Be cautious to avoid making use of an attachment factor that can relocate or enable the strap to slide, consisting of any kind of bracket or item that rotates along with your swingarm or back suspension. You'll also need to stay away from your bike's hot exhaust pipes. Maintain clear of the chain and wheels.


If your motorbike does not have attachment points, you can include your own. Check out the equipment store for creative choices. Business like Huge Loop and Mosko Moto sell details add-on rings. Or consider upgrading to an aftermarket back rack that has a bigger surface area and more add-on loops than an OEM shelf.
